Brice Marden, a titan in the realm of contemporary art, is celebrated for his relentless exploration of line, color, and surface. His work, often characterized by a rigorous yet poetic approach to abstraction, has left an indelible mark on the minimalist and post-minimalist movements. Marden's art demands contemplation, rewarding viewers with a depth of experience that unfolds gradually, revealing layers of intention and emotion. The "Polke Letter" from 2011 is a quintessential example of Marden's later style, where his iconic grid structures evolved into intricate, almost calligraphic webs of lines. This particular work represents a fascinating intersection of Marden's meticulous abstraction and a possible dialogue or homage to his contemporary, Sigmar Polke, a groundbreaking German artist known for his experimental and often subversive approach to art-making. The "Letter" in the title suggests communication, a message, or a written form, which resonates deeply with the visual language Marden employs. In the "Polke Letter," Marden orchestrates a dense tapestry of interwoven lines that traverse the entire canvas. These lines are not merely static boundaries; they possess a dynamic energy, appearing to flow, intertwine, and overlap, creating a sense of continuous motion within a carefully constructed framework. The original painting would have been built up through multiple layers of paint, wax, and oil, giving its surface a rich, almost three-dimensional quality that hints at hidden depths and subtle textural variations. While a fine art poster translates this to a flat surface, the exceptional printing quality preserves the integrity of Marden's intricate linework and the subtle interplay of light and shadow that defines his compositions. The color palette in "Polke Letter" is typically Mardenesque: sophisticated, restrained, yet incredibly nuanced. While specific colors can vary slightly in reproductions, Marden often works with a limited spectrum of deep, earthy tones, muted grays, or subtle greens and blues, punctuated by areas of brighter, almost iridescent hues that seem to glow from beneath the surface. These colors are not applied flatly but are allowed to interact, creating an optical vibration that lends a quiet intensity to the piece. The overall effect is one of profound tranquility mixed with a subtle, almost rhythmic energy. The lines themselves often carry varying thicknesses and opacities, contributing to an illusion of depth and a perception of the viewer looking through different planes of an abstract space.
